Vention is looking for a Mechanical Assembler Team Lead to join our dynamic Operations team In this leadership role, you will not only be responsible for assembling high-quality sub-assemblies and productized applications but also for guiding and supporting the assembly team to ensure efficiency, quality, and continuous improvement. If you have a strong mechanical mindset, enjoy hands-on work, and are passionate about leading a team in a fast-paced environment, this is the perfect opportunity for you
What You'll Do:
- Lead, mentor, and motivate the mechanical assembly team to meet production goals and uphold Vention's high standards.
- Assemble a variety of components, from simple to complex, including palletizers, conveyors, robot cells, machine tending applications, and safety enclosures based on engineering instructions.
- Build and integrate automation components to complete custom automation designs.
- Conduct quality control checks before shipping to ensure all products meet Vention's high standards.
- Oversee and coordinate team workflows, ensuring tasks are assigned effectively to meet deadlines and priorities.
- Pick and pack orders in accordance with Vention's quality standards.
- Identify and report discrepancies or missing information to maintain accuracy and efficiency.
- Support team members in troubleshooting mechanical or process-related issues.
- Contribute to continuous improvement by optimizing integration and warehouse processes.
- Update internal systems with assembly details to ensure accurate tracking.
- Foster a collaborative and high-performance culture within the team.
